The Committee on Payment and Settlement Systems (CPSS) and the World Bank have issued a new report entitled General Principles for International Remittance Services, which provides an analysis of the payment system aspects of remittances and outlines principles designed to assist countries that are seeking to improve the market for remittance services.

The report examines transparency and consumer protection; payment system infrastructure; the legal and regulatory framework; market structure and competition; and governance and risk management in relation to remittances. The report has been prepared for the CPSS and the World Bank by a task force consisting of representatives from international financial institutions and from central banks in both remittance-sending and remittance-receiving countries.
